Comparing RTP Rates Across Various Gaming Options
Casino games vary considerably in their RTP percentages, with some offering substantially better returns than others. Blackjack typically leads the pack with RTPs reaching 99.5% when played with optimal strategy, while certain slot machines may offer rates as low as 85%. Understanding non GamStop casino becomes particularly important when you realize that a 5% difference in RTP can translate to thousands of dollars over extended play. Table games generally provide superior return rates compared to slots, with European roulette averaging 97.3%, baccarat around 98.9%, and craps offering specific bets above 98%. These differences aren’t trivial—they represent the mathematical edge that separates casual entertainment from informed gambling decisions.
Slot machines present the widest RTP variance among gaming options, ranging from 85% to over 98% depending on the individual game selection. Progressive jackpot slots typically sit at the bottom range of this spectrum, sacrificing base RTP to fund substantial prize pools. Video poker machines can deliver exceptional returns, with some variants like full-pay Deuces Wild reaching 100.76% when executed correctly. The relationship between non GamStop casino becomes crystal clear when comparing a 96% slot to an 88% alternative—over 10,000 spins wagering $1 each, you’d theoretically lose $400 versus $1,200. This significant gap underscores why studying RTP percentages before investing your money is non-negotiable for serious players.
Live dealer options have introduced another dimension to RTP comparisons, generally mirroring their digital counterparts but with slight variations. Lightning Roulette and other enhanced live games may include adjusted RTPs to account for bonus features and multiplier mechanics. Popular Myths About RTP and Winning Patterns
Numerous players wrongly assume that RTP guarantees specific outcomes during separate gaming periods, resulting in disappointment when reality doesn’t match expectations. The most prevalent myth suggests that if a gaming machine has a 96% RTP, players should expect to get $96 for every $100 played during a one session. Understanding non GamStop casino requires recognizing that these percentages apply across many millions of spins, not single play sessions. This core misunderstanding causes players to take poor actions, follow losses, or abandon perfectly good games ahead of time based on immediate outcomes that have nothing to do with the actual mathematical advantage.
Another common misconception involves the “hot” and “cold” machine theory, where players believe certain games are “due” to pay out based on recent activity. Modern slot machines and casino games operate using RNG technology that produce separate outcomes for each spin, making previous outcomes irrelevant to future results. Players who grasp non GamStop casino understand that each spin carries the same mathematical expectation regardless of what happened before. This false belief leads gamblers to waste time tracking patterns, switching machines unnecessarily, or increasing bets based on perceived trends that simply don’t exist in genuinely random gaming systems.
Some players also mix up RTP and hit frequency, assuming that higher return percentages automatically mean more frequent wins during gameplay. A game might have an outstanding 98% RTP but only hit winning combinations 15% of the time, while another with 94% RTP could deliver wins on 40% of spins. Recognizing non GamStop casino means knowing that RTP calculates total payouts over time, not how often you’ll celebrate small victories. This distinction proves crucial for budget control and game selection, as players with limited budgets might prefer frequent smaller payouts even if the overall return percentage is marginally reduced.

Q: Do internet gambling sites provide higher payout rates than physical casino locations?
Online casinos typically provide superior RTP percentages compared to their land-based counterparts, often by significant margins. Digital slots commonly feature RTPs between 95-98%, while physical casino slots frequently range from 85-92%, particularly in high-traffic tourist destinations. This difference exists because online operators face lower overhead costs—no physical real estate, fewer staff members, and reduced operational expenses. The competitive nature of non GamStop casino becomes more apparent online, where players can easily compare options and switch platforms. Online casinos also display RTP information more transparently, allowing informed decisions. Table games show less variation between online and offline venues since their rules largely determine RTP, though online platforms often offer more favorable rule variations.
Q: Does bet size impact the RTP percentage of a game?
Bet size does not alter the fundamental RTP percentage programmed into a game’s software. A slot machine with 96% RTP maintains that percentage whether you wager $0.10 or $100 per spin. The mathematics of non GamStop casino remain constant regardless of stake levels, as the game’s algorithm applies the same probability distributions to all bet amounts. However, bet size dramatically affects variance and bankroll longevity. Larger bets deplete your funds faster during losing streaks, potentially preventing you from reaching the long-term play required for RTP to manifest accurately. Some games feature progressive jackpots or bonus tiers that require maximum bets for eligibility, which can effectively alter your overall expected return if those features contribute significantly to the base RTP calculation.
